Why Screw Piles? The Hidden Science of Solar Stability

  • Geotechnical Wizardry: The HANA N1's helix design mimics tree root systems, distributing weight like nature's own engineering
  • Torque-to-Capacity Ratio: Our 2024 field tests showed 40% faster installation than conventional concrete footings
  • Corrosion Combat: Triple-layer zinc-aluminum coating outlasts standard galvanization by 2.5x
